Eye Examination Required to Renew Driver's License

A vision examination is a requirement when getting a new driver's license or restoring one. The outcomes of the test figure out if you can drive without constraint.

The standard is visual acuity 20/40 or much better in each eye without any restorative lenses and a peripheral field of 140 degrees. If you have a vision professional report revealing that you need telescopic lenses to meet the requirement, a restriction for daytime driving will be placed on your driver's license.
Visual Acuity

The visual acuity test measures how well you can see. It compares your vision to that of a typical person at 20 feet (6 meters) away. The number you get informs you the tiniest line of letters or numbers you can continue reading a standardized chart called a Snellen chart or an ETDRS chart. You need to read the smallest line of letters that you can see and react to the examiner with the name of the letter. The tiniest letters on the chart are printed in black; numbers, lines or images are utilized for people who can not read.

You can find numerous at-home visual acuity tests in print and on smartphone apps, however they can't change an eye exam in the center. Your medical professional can provide you pointers on how to take home skill tests precisely.

A basic Snellen chart has rows of capital letters with progressively smaller sized sizes. Your eye care professional will ask you to check out each row of letters till you can no longer properly determine them. One eye is evaluated at a time. Your eye care specialist may utilize a different type of chart, such as a random E chart. This has images of capital letters facing different instructions that you read from a range of 20 feet.

If you have an excellent reading on the Snellen chart, your vision is regular for a healthy individual. If you have a bad reading, your vision is listed below the minimum requirement for your state's driver's license.

Your eye health is necessary and you must take steps to preserve it. The very best method to do this is to have routine eye assessments and wear protective sunglasses when you are outdoors. Visual Field

A visual field test measures how much of your surroundings you can see. It can help your eye care service provider discover early signs of diseases like glaucoma that gradually damage vision. It can also show whether treatments for a condition like glaucoma are working. Your eye care supplier will utilize numerous tests to determine your visual fields. One basic technique is called the cover test or conflict visual field assessment. The eye care service provider will hold up different numbers of fingers and ask you to identify them with your peripheral vision. It's a quick method to screen for problems, but it's not conscious little problems. The Goldmann or Humphrey visual field analyzer is a more precise method to assess your visual fields. It's more accurate than the cover test, but it requires an unique device and is more pricey.

Telescopic Lenses

A person who wears telescopic lenses on their glasses can see objects that are further away than those seen with routine eyeglasses. However, there are some limitations to driving with these lenses. A vision test need to be performed to figure out if the wearer is able to drive safely. Normally, the test will be performed at an eye care specialist's workplace, but it can likewise be finished by your medical professional.

The testing includes measuring your depth understanding and the ability to distinguish colors. Depth understanding is a really essential ability since it permits you to gauge how far you require to be from the lorry ahead of you, or whether there suffices range between you and the vehicle in front of you when passing another driver. Color vision is very important because it enables you to recognize different traffic signals and road indications.

Daylight Driving

If your visual acuity is not 20/40 with or without corrective lenses, you are required to see a specialist. The physician will offer a Vision Test Report (DL 62) which you should provide at the DMV throughout your driver's license renewal process. Your eye doctor or optometrist will determine whether you have enough peripheral vision to safely operate an automobile and might also carry out a color loss of sight test.

If you have a visual skill of 20/40 or much better in one eye and an undisturbed, binocular field of at least 140 degrees and an uninterrupted monocular field of 70 degrees, then you are eligible for an unlimited driver's license. If your acuity is 20/60 in both eyes, you may acquire a limited license for daylight driving just. If your visual skill is 20/200 or worse in either eye, or you have a continuous visual field of less than 130 degrees combined or 140 degrees binocular and 35 degrees nasal monocular, then you are not eligible for a driver's license.

If your skill is 20/60 or worse in both eyes, you can still get a restricted driver's license if you pass a driving test performed by two highway patrol examiners and you have a legitimate vision test report from an eye expert. You will be enabled to drive during daylight hours and should abide by the restrictions and conditions defined in the DL 62 form. The restrictions include, but are not restricted to, driving within an affordable radius of home, no highway driving and constraints on speed. You will likewise need to have your acuity and field of vision tested every year by an eye expert and your driving record will be reviewed. Any offense of the limitations will lead to a suspension of your telescopic lens driver's license.
